NetraMark Holdings Inc. faces a significant setback as its stock drops nearly 7% in a single trading session.

In the latest trading session, NetraMark Holdings Inc. (AIAI.TO) saw its stock price tumble by 6.98%, closing at CA$0.80. This decline raises questions about the company's current market position and future prospects, especially following recent strategic communications efforts.

Understanding the Decline

The 6.98% drop in NetraMark's stock price on the TSX likely stems from market sentiment and investor skepticism regarding the company's recent initiatives. Even with AM Public Relations on board to enhance its communication strategy, the immediate market reaction shows that investors are cautious about how effective these efforts will be.

Future Outlook

As NetraMark Holdings Inc. continues to develop its NetraAI platform, the company needs to show real results to regain investor confidence. Working with AM PR is a positive step, but the market will be watching closely for signs of progress and partnerships that can validate the company's value in the competitive AI landscape.
